Intra-African Trade Fair a reality of structural transformation - Ivorian minister

Abidjan, Cote d'Ivoire (PANA) - The Intra-African Trade Fair (IATF) will lead to the structural transformation of the African economy, Minister of Trade of Côte d'Ivoire Souleymane Diarrasouba. said here Monday. 

Mr. Diarrasouba, who was speaking at the signing of the agreement to host the third Intra-African Trade Fair by his country, said the IATF was now positioned as the most important trade event in the whole of Africa.

"It is an opportunity for our economic operators to show the reality of the structural transformation of our economies through industrialization, to present their products and services, to engage in business to business exchanges, exchanges between companies and the private sector, to create joint ventures and to conclude mutually beneficial trade agreements.

"The IATF is considered a sign and a locomotive for the smooth running of AfCFTA. It is also the showcase of the single African market of more than 1.3 billion consumers," he stated.

Diarrasouba said the event represented a commendable initiative to substantially increase trade between African countries which still remained low at around 16 per cent in spite of the continent's enormous potential.

"It also represents multi-sectoral development issues for Africa," he said.

Between 15,000 and 20,000 participants are expected to attend the third edition of this fair scheduled from 21-27 November 2023 at the Abidjan Exhibition Centre in Côte d'Ivoire.

The IATF is an initiative put in place as part of the operationalization of the African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A) by the African Union, in partnership with Afreximbank, for the promotion of intra-African trade.
